Unicode: U+1F637
Shortcodes: :mask:
Sick, contagious, or being cautious about health. Post-COVID cultural shift.
Being sick or wearing a mask.
Example: โCaught a cold ๐ทโ
Being cautious or avoiding something toxic.
Example: โStaying away from that drama ๐ทโ
Working while sick or health precautions.
Example: โWFH today, feeling under the weather ๐ทโ
Something is so bad it's contagious.
Example: โThat take is toxic ๐ทโ
Usage increased dramatically during COVID-19 pandemic.
Common for sick day notifications.
Used to communicate illness in family groups.
Also used metaphorically for avoiding toxic situations.
Post-pandemic, uses for illness and mask-wearing.
Used straightforwardly for sickness.
